WebDisability Living Allowance (DLA) is a benefit for people who have difficulty with everyday tasks or getting around. You can’t make a new claim for DLA if you’re 16 or over – check what other benefits you might be able to claim. WebOct 18, 2011 · Yes you can. You can get Disability Living Allowance (DLA) whether or not you work and the benefit isn't usually affected by any savings or income you may have. DLA is based on your care and mobility needs, not ability to work. ...
